The Escape

The Escape

Dugesia

Recent comments

  • IamTasha

    This track feel raw and organic its like your in the room ri…

  • Robert Grigg

    wow!

  • The Monster In Me

    Good solid fundament but u have to be a little carefull with…

Avatar

Related tracks

See all